Trade paperback. 250 pages. Select Bibliography, Index. Translated, with commentary, by James T. Sheridan. First edition. A rendering into prose of one of the 12th century French theologian and poet’s most famous poems, the “Anticlaudianus, a treatise on morals as allegory, the form of which recalls the pamphlet of Claudian against Rufinus.” No previous ownership marks.
